The Lifespan of a Robot Hoover

A vacuum and mop that is top of the line, eliminates (most of) obstacles and works well on rugs. The app can be used to schedule regular cleanings, or send it to specific areas or rooms, and set the zone as a no-go zone.

It's easy to keep this robot in top condition by examining its brushes for hairs that have become tangled as well as emptying and cleaning the base and wiping off sensors and cameras regularly.

Features

A robot hoover is an efficient household appliance that can sweep, vacuum and mop floors, without needing to lift a hand. The latest models come with smart mapping technology that allows them to remember the layout of your house and avoid obstacles without difficulty. You can also control them with voice assistants and smartphones. Some even come with charging stations that empty their trash bins and fill the water tanks on board, enhancing the hands-free experience.

It is important that the robot cleaner has strong suction capacity, since this determines how clean it will be. It is measured in Pa (Pascals), and a higher number signifies a stronger cleaner. It is recommended to select a model with at least 3,000Pa for more effective results. A suction system with high suction can quickly eliminate pet hairs, dirt particles, dead skin cells, and other debris.

Most robot vacuums have side brushes that help them reach corners and other difficult areas. They also can detect flooring type and adjust pressure to suit. For example, they will employ more force to vacuum carpets than tiles. Certain vacuums come with additional features like "dirt sensing" which analyses the amount dust that is present in the machine and prompts the vacuum to re-vacuum. Another feature is "freo" which allows it to make its own cleaning decisions.

At first, robot vacuums were equipped with simple bump sensors that triggered when they hit an object. Later, infrared sensors were added that helped them avoid snagging on furniture or other heavy objects. Certain advanced robots have crossed infrared sensors and 3D structured light technology that project a pattern onto the surroundings and analyze how it reflects back to determine the size of objects in the vicinity.

Once a robot vacuum is finished its task of cleaning it will return to its docking station to recharge. It will continue where it left off unless it is necessary to restart manually. Some models with premium features have a self-emptying top, which eliminates the need to manually empty the dust bin or determine whether there are hairs tangled. Depending on the size of the dustbin it could require emptying every few cleanings or more frequently.

Battery life

The battery is the main component of every robot vacuum cleaner, and its durability is essential to the appliance's performance. The life span of a robot vacuum cleaner hoover is determined by the model, its use and maintenance practices. The battery type is important and lithium-ion offers the highest energy density and longevity that lasts for a long time and a low degradation between charging cycles and discharge.

The software on a robot hoover is another crucial factor, as manufacturers regularly release updates to address operational issues and improve navigation algorithms. These upgrades boost the appliance's efficiency and decrease unnecessary power consumption. The latest software also improves battery management, extending the device's runtime and overall life span.

To ensure optimal performance, it's important to replace worn-out components such as filters, brushes, and mops. This will prolong the lifespan of the device. Removing these parts frequently will help prevent obstructions or wear and keeping the robotic vacuum clean can help ensure the battery's protection.

The battery life can vary based on the device's usage and care as well as the frequency of use, with more frequent usage decreasing its lifespan when compared to infrequent or light use. The battery can be damaged by storing the device at extreme temperatures or handling it roughly. The battery of a robot vacuum should be charged before each cleaning session and kept in a temperature-controlled environment to minimize its degradation.
